Responsibilities

  • Develop and manage the maintenance training curriculum by utilizing outside vendor training and partnering with RPM Training Department.
  • Design and implement preventative maintenance program for all properties.
  • Work with vendors, regional managers, and lead maintenance technicians to identify cost saving opportunities with vendors.
  • Negotiate and manage annual schedule of items to reduce long term costs.
  • Assist and review scope of work for Capex items.
  • Assist Regional Managers with troubleshooting larger maintenance issues.
  • Assist Regional Facilities managers with navigating their portfolio
  • Oversee multiple regions and markets
  • Manage the Multiple Director of Facilities
  • Assist Clients Services in acquiring new clients
  • Recruit, interview, and onboard maintenance technicians.
  • Inspect properties for compliance
  • Work with vendors for reduce pricing
  • Develop monthly Safety meetings.
  • Develop on-site hands-on training with help of training department
  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• One year certificate from college or technical school; or three to six months related experience
    and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Prior experience as a Regional Maintenance Director in the multifamily industry
  • Must have managed mutiple markets and corporate level direct reports
  • Must have previous experience creating companywide SOPs and training.
  • EPA or HVAC Certification
  • CPO certification preferred.
  • Valid Driver’s License
  • Microsoft Office Suite, Project Management, Adobe, Yardi
